Typical Issues with Commercial Patio Doors

Comprehending the normal problems faced by patio doors can assist company owner identify when repairs are essential. Here are some regular issues:

1. Misalignment

Symptoms: Difficulty in opening and shutting the doors, spaces at the edges.

2. Broken Locks

Signs: Inability to protect the door, noticeable damage to the locking mechanism.

3. Glass Damage

Symptoms: Cracks, chips, or foggy glass, showing seal failure.

4. Weather Condition Stripping Issues

Symptoms: Drafts going into through the door, increased energy expenses due to poor insulation.

5. Worn-Out Rollers

Signs: Sticking or sliding troubles, loud sound throughout operation.

4. Regular Maintenance

Establish a set up maintenance plan to regularly examine the performance of patio doors. This can consist of cleaning up the tracks, examining seals, and lubing moving parts.

Frequently Asked Question About Commercial Patio Door Repairs

Q1: How often should industrial patio doors be inspected?

A1: It is a good idea to examine commercial patio doors a minimum of two times a year, or more regularly depending on usage and direct exposure to elements.

Q2: Can I replace the glass myself?

A2: While changing the glass is possible for some knowledgeable individuals, it's often best delegated specialists to guarantee it's set up correctly and safely.

Q3: What should I do if my patio door is stuck?

A3: First, check for obstructions in the tracks. If the door remains stuck, examine the rollers and hinges-- these may need changes or lubrication. If problems persist, an expert must be sought advice from.

Q4: How can I improve the energy efficiency of my patio door?

A4: Consider updating to insulated glass, guaranteeing appropriate sealing around the door, and replacing used weather stripping to enhance energy efficiency.

Q5: Are there particular maintenance items you suggest?

A5: Use silicone-based lubes for rollers and moving parts, and moderate soap solutions for cleaning glass panels and frames to prevent damaging the surfaces.
